I have one nnimap server and two imap mail-sources (one of which is
the same server as the nnimap server). Everything works hunky-dory
until I add :stream tls to either or both of the imap mail-sources.
Everything works fine for a while, but eventually I get an error with
a backtrace that looks like this:
